Output 50b6657f17c3b20fdf6282a4835837672826b5786bdaea68bde0e996c8ca925b:0

value
5080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ac608233563b134ed4e3112e8cb7d13ef9c9921 OP_EQUAL
address
3CtBbSHrmjETGUWWULHwFbxhrZBqAb6pXu
transaction
50b6657f17c3b20fdf6282a4835837672826b5786bdaea68bde0e996c8ca925b
spent
true